This is the Diagnosis and Tests technical manual (TM134219) for 2015-2021 John Deere 5085M, 5100M, 5100MH, 5100ML, 5115M and 5115ML tractors. It is the book you open when a code appears or something quits: trouble-code diagnostics for the CCU, ECU, EIC, HCU, ICC, JDLink and PTR controllers, symptom charts, circuit-by-circuit electrical schematics with matching component locations and connector pinouts, plus live tests with real target values - relief pressures, clutch leak-check limits, cooler flows, hitch cycle times. Written for the Final Tier 4, CAN bus era of the 5M line, in both PowrReverser and SyncShuttle versions. Be clear on scope: this is the find-the-fault manual, not the teardown manual. Quick Reference Specifications

SpecificationValuePage
All models
Main relief valve pressure19000 - 20000 kPa (190 - 200 bar) (2756 - 2901 psi)p. 1775
Hitch cylinder supply pressure (raise)19000 - 20000 kPa (190 - 200 bar)p. 1766
Hitch load-sense relief pressure19000 - 20000 kPa (190 - 200 bar)p. 1768
Implement relief valve pressure19000 - 20000 kPa (190 - 200 bar)p. 1772
Mechanical hitch surge relief valve cracking pressure23000 - 24000 kPa (230 - 240 bar)p. 1769
Rear SCV detent kick-out pressure16000 - 19000 kPa (160 - 190 bar)p. 1774
Triple mid-mount SCV maximum flow40 L/min (10.5 gpm)p. 1771
Implement pump standby pressure (controls in neutral)0 - 500 kPa (0 - 5 bar)p. 1776
Hitch cycle raise time2.5 - 3.5 secondsp. 1676
Hitch settling wear limit56 mm cylinders: max 3.0 mm (0.12 in.) drop in 15 minutesp. 1676
SCV pressure holdstays above 3450 kPa (34.5 bar) for at least 5 secondsp. 1778
Steering relief valve pressure (full left turn)13000 - 13700 kPa (130 - 137 bar) (1885 - 1987 psi)p. 1647
Steering pump minimum flow (1000 rpm at 150 bar)10.6 L/min (2.8 gpm)p. 1646
Transmission system 1 pressure (steering neutral)1150 - 1250 kPa (11.5 - 12.5 bar)p. 1645
Brake retractor adjustment pressure3000 - 4000 kPa (30 - 40 bar)p. 1642
System 2 pressure at 1000 rpm1100 - 1200 kPa (11.0 - 12.0 bar)p. 1600
System 1 preliminary pressure at 1000 rpm1200 kPa (12 bar) (174 psi)p. 1579
Engagement override valve (EOV) pressure at 1000 rpm1200 kPa (12 bar)p. 1597
MFWD / PTO clutch / differential lock engaged pressure1200 kPa (12 bar) (174 psi)p. 1571
Clutch and MFWD leak-check wear limitmaximum differential pressure 17 kPa (0.17 bar) (2.5 psi)p. 1570
System 2 to clutch leak-check limitmaximum pressure difference 207 kPa (2.07 bar) (30 psi)p. 1581
Alternator output90 A at 13.2 V (open station) / 120 A at 13.2 V (cab)p. 1279
CAN bus voltagesCAN Hi circuit 9914: 2.50 - 3.50 Vp. 1290
EH hitch valve raise solenoid nut torque10 +/- 1 N.m (7 +/- 1 lb-ft)p. 1358
Air conditioning compressor clutch air gap0.35 - 0.65 mm (0.014 - 0.026 in.)p. 1814
A/C test coupling valve stem depth7 - 7.6 mm (0.275 - 0.300 in.)p. 1812
PowrReverser (PR) transmission
Transmission cooler flow at 1000 rpm8.3 L/min (2.19 gpm)p. 1594
SyncShuttle (SS) transmission
Transmission cooler flow at 1000 rpm10.4 L/min (2.45 gpm)p. 1594

John Deere 5085M / 5100M / 5100MH / 5100ML / 5115M / 5115ML Common Problems This Manual Covers

PowrReverser clutch slipping or tractor creeping, and you dread splitting it to find out why

The drive systems section diagnoses clutch packs with a gauge, not a split. Engaged clutch pressure should read 1200 kPa (174 psi); the leak check allows at most 17 kPa (2.5 psi) differential, and system 2 to clutch at most 207 kPa. Out of limit points to the leaking pack before you pull anything apart.

Manual Section: Drive Systems And Transmissions (Section 250) p. 1583
Tractor will not crank, or cranks only in certain lever positions

Neutral start is transmission-specific: the schematics section carries separate SS and PR neutral-start circuits alongside the key switch, starter and alternator circuit. Confirm your transmission first, then trace that exact SE circuit through its schematic, component locations and connector pinouts to the open switch or broken wire.

Manual Section: Electrical Schematics (Section 240B) p. 438
Multiple controllers logging communication codes at once, dash acting possessed

That pattern usually means CAN bus trouble, not seven failed controllers. The electrical theory section explains how the CCU, ECU, cluster and the rest talk on the bus, and the tests give a hard target: CAN Hi circuit 9914 should measure 2.50 to 3.50 V. Chase the bus wiring before condemning modules.

Manual Section: Electrical General And Theory Of Operation (Section 240A) p. 1290
Steering feels heavy or slow and you are not sure if it is the pump or the valve

The steering and brakes section pins it down with two measurements: steering relief at full left turn should read 13000 to 13700 kPa (1885 to 1987 psi), and the steering pump must deliver at least 10.6 L/min at 1000 rpm against 150 bar. Low flow condemns the pump; low relief points at the valve.

Manual Section: Steering And Brakes (Section 260) p. 1647

My 5100M transmission threw a fault. Where do I start?

Start by confirming which transmission you have, because these tractors came as PowrReverser (PR) or SyncShuttle (SS) and the manual splits accordingly: separate neutral-start schematics, separate CCU diagnostic groups, even different cooler flow targets (8.3 L/min for PR vs 10.4 L/min for SS at 1000 rpm). Follow the wrong branch and you chase ghosts. PowrReverser faults land in the PTR code family, and the drive systems section backs the codes with pressure tests you run with a gauge. p. 1594

The hitch and hydraulics feel weak. Can I actually test them with this manual?

Yes, with numbers instead of feel. Main relief should hold 19000 to 20000 kPa (190 to 200 bar), same target for hitch supply and implement relief. Pump standby with controls in neutral is 0 to 500 kPa. The hitch itself has pass/fail wear checks: a full raise in 2.5 to 3.5 seconds, and on 56 mm cylinders no more than 3.0 mm of settle in 15 minutes. SCV detent kick-out is 16000 to 19000 kPa. One gauge tells you pump, valve or cylinder. p. 1676
